+ FTL B3 does not logicalNot correctly
+ https://bugs.webkit.org/show_bug.cgi?id=152512
+
+ Reviewed by Saam Barati.
+
+ I'm working on a bug where V8/richards does not run correctly. I noticed that the codegen was
+ doing a log of Not32's followed by branches, which smelled like badness. To debug this, I
+ needed B3's origins to dump as something other than a hexed pointer to a node. The node index
+ would be better. So, I added the notion of an origin printer to Procedure.
+
+ The bug was easy enough to fix. This introduces Output::logicalNot(). In LLVM, it's the same
+ as bitNot(). In B3, it's compiled to Equal(value, 0). We could have also compiled it to
+ BitXor(value, 1), except that B3 will strength-reduce to that anyway whenever it's safe. It's
+ sort of nice that right now, you could use logicalNot() on non-bool values and get C-like
+ behavior.
+
+ Richards still doesn't run, though. There are more bugs!

+ FTL B3 does not logicalNot correctly
+ https://bugs.webkit.org/show_bug.cgi?id=152512
+
+ Reviewed by Saam Barati.
+
+ This change introduces yet another use of SharedTask in JSC. While doing this, I noticed that
+ SharedTask::run() always demands that whatever arguments the callback takes, they must be
+ passed as rvalue references. This was a clear misuse of perfect forwarding. This change makes
+ SharedTask's approach to forwarding match what we were already doing in ScopedLambda.
